Untitled
unknown
javascript
a year ago
598 B
9
Indexable
<template>
<div>
<ul>
<li v-for="user in users" :key="user.id">
{{ user.name }} - <strong>{{ user.active ? 'Active' : 'Inactive' }}</strong>
<button @click="toggleActive(user)">Toggle Active</button>
</li>
</ul>
</div>
</template>
<script>
import { reactive } from 'vue';
export default {
setup() {
const users = reactive([
{ id: 1, name: 'Alice', active: false },
{ id: 2, name: 'Bob', active: true }
]);
function toggleActive(user) {
user.active = !user.active;
}
return { users, toggleActive };
}
}
</script>
Editor is loading...
Leave a Comment